North 6th Street Construction Now Complete

Share

**photo courtesy of the Monmouth College Facebook Page

The North 6th Street road reconstruction in the City of Monmouth is now complete and Mayor Rod Davies reports the new asphalt is laying over the brick paved road:

“We had to get the utilities underground first and then we have been back and forth a number of times about whether we needed to remove all bricks from the old brick road that were there. This last go around, they came up with an idea and a new binder to help the asphalt stick to those bricks that we were allowed to leave them in place, remove some of the soft spots and fill in with concrete. It certainly took about $1 million off the price tag for the project, so that helped move this project forward as well.”

Additionally, in the City of Monmouth $813,000 has been spent to date on residential improvements and $1.8 million on business construction totals.
